Crea un profilo in modo da poter essere trovato dalle aziende, ottenere offerte di lavoro più adatte alle tue esigenze e candidarti più velocemente.
  • Cerca lavoro
  • Preferiti
  • Crea CV
    Novità
  • Stipendi
  • Iscrizioni

Remote Java Engineer

AODocs

AODocs is a software company created in 2012 that makes a Content Services SaaS platform. It is included by Gartner (in its Magic Quadrant) and Forrester (in its Wave) as one of the top and most innovative players in the content services space, in a market populated by legacy on‐premises competitors like IBM FileNet, Documentum, and OpenText that are approaching end of life. Our product is used by large organizations such as Google, Veolia or Colgate to control their critical documents, protecting them against costly human errors while accelerating key business processes. Our client's main use cases are document control for large engineering projects, standard operating procedures, quality management, consulting and audit reports, and more generally, all business processes involving important documents in professional services, healthcare, HR, procurement, legal, and more.

The generative AI wave represents an important opportunity for AODocs, as more and more companies realize that AI assistants cannot work on messy information. AODocs' ability to control documents and their versions can be used to ensure AI assistants only work on the right, validated content, thus allowing AODocs to benefit from the AI market traction.

We are looking for a highly motivated Backend Engineer to join our growing team! The Backend Engineer is responsible for the end‐to‐end development of core parts of our web apps. We expect you to help us take our products and our team to the next technical level and to teach us something we don't know.

You will work closely with the Product and Frontend teams, sometimes in squads, and with ad hoc teams meant to quickly address specific matters.

Taking part in the operations team to make sure we do not go below our 99.87 % uptime

Writing technical specifications

Proactively proposing code and performance improvements

Helping set and maintain a high professional standard

Helping build and evolve our architecture

Potential projects

Build one of the new services we are planning to work on this year, such as the integration with SAP and Salesforce, the extension of our cold storage capacities to AWS S3 and Azure Blob Storage, or the inclusion of data‐centered services to provide OCR and data recognition capabilities to our product.

Work on the integration with Office 365 and other Microsoft products such as Teams.

Reduce our technical legacy, reduce our dependency on AppEngine, plan the migration toward a more recent version of Java (we run mainly Java 8).

Fix what slows down our release cycle in the code.

Added a new identity system allowing users to connect with Microsoft accounts and soon with "normal" emails and passwords.

Implemented an object storage service to act as a middle layer between AODocs and any storage we would like to add to it.

You care more about making reliable software used by many than a shiny unstable thing used by no one. You understand that engineering work is done first and foremost for the customers.

Fully capable of taking substantial features from concept to shipping as the sole developer.

Experience: 8 years as a professional developer on SaaS products.

Deep, hands‐on expertise in Java and the Spring/Spring Boot ecosystem. Any experience with Cloud providers is a plus. Python, Go, Ruby, C++, C#.

Flexible full remote policy with a monthly trip to Milan.

#

Offerta di lavoro pubblicata 2 mesi fa